Understanding Network Infrastructure Components

A well-structured network infrastructure consists of various components that work in tandem to facilitate communication and data exchange. The primary elements include:

  • Hardware: Routers, switches, firewalls, and servers are essential for directing and managing internet traffic. These devices ensure that information is routed effectively to its destination.
  • Software: Network management software allows for monitoring and control of network traffic, ensuring optimum performance and security. Key software solutions include Network Operating Systems (NOS) and firewalls.
  • Protocols: Communication standards, such as TCP/IP, define how data is transmitted across networks, ensuring compatibility between devices and reliability in data transfer.

Understanding each of these components is imperative for building an efficient network infrastructure. Together, they enable seamless connectivity and robust performance, which are essential for processes such as data sharing, hosting applications, and online transactions.

The Importance of a Well-Designed Network Infrastructure

A well-conceived network infrastructure is not merely a technical necessity; it plays a pivotal role in enhancing overall business efficiency. A few notable advantages include:

  • Scalability: A well-structured network enables businesses to expand their operations with ease. Adding new users or locations becomes a straightforward process when the underlying infrastructure can accommodate growth.
  • Security: With rising cyber threats, sturdy network designs incorporate security measures such as firewalls and intrusion detection systems. This layered approach helps safeguard sensitive information.
  • Performance: Optimized networks minimize downtime and latency, which is crucial for maintaining productivity and providing a seamless user experience.

Investing in robust network infrastructure not only strengthens operational capabilities but also fosters a secure environment for critical data and applications.
